Ticket: orders table soft-delete drift

Prod has soft deletes enabled on the Cartmill orders table; staging hard-deletes. Restore testing is therefore meaningless in staging. Someone flipped the flag months ago and it was never synced. Align staging to prod and add a drift check. The intended settings for both environments follow.

settings of fadug-haduf:
SORETH_PIN=8625
SORETH_TENANT=wendor
SORETH_METRICS_HOST=metrics.soreth.sivrelhq.local
SORETH_SEAL=seal_ceebd504
SORETH_STANDBY_TEAM=quenius

The Thornbeck quota service enforces per-tenant rate limits across the Opaline API gateway. Because quota math directly affects customer billing disputes, every deployed artifact must be traceable to a signed build. Before changing any limit constants, verify that the running binary matches the attested artifact in the provenance store; never trust the version string alone, since it is set at compile time and can drift from the manifest. The currently attested production artifact is identified by the token below.

pipeline stamp: htk31_f769b577b3028a4e9958e5bb8d1259a

**Wiki: Break-Glass Access — Fernmap Offline Mode**

If a field crew is stuck offline and their Fernmap sync token expires mid-survey, on-call can grant break-glass access without the auth service. Don't do this casually — it bypasses audit hooks until the next sync. Open the admin panel, pick "offline override," and when prompted, enter the recovery passphrase printed directly below.

recovery phrase for bawif-hahif: ralael-tamdor

## Configuration

Timetable generation in Slatewick runs against the constraint engine defined in solver.toml. Most knobs — period length, room capacity weights, teacher availability windows — have sane defaults and rarely need changes. The one thing every deployment must set is the license credential for the Hexbell solver backend, since unsigned requests are rejected after the trial window. Copy env.sample to .env, adjust SOLVER_THREADS if the host has fewer than eight cores, then add the backend credential on the next line:

sealed setting: ARCHIVE_KEY3=8d0